A South Dakota contract to employ attorney on a fixed fee basis refers to a legal arrangement wherein individuals or businesses in South Dakota hire an attorney under a contract specifying a predetermined fee for the legal services provided. This type of agreement ensures transparency and predictability in terms of legal costs, making it an attractive option for clients who want to control their legal expenses. When entering into a contract to employ an attorney on a fixed fee basis in South Dakota, clients can typically choose from various types of attorneys specializing in different legal areas. Some common types of South Dakota contract to employ attorneys on a fixed fee basis include: 1. Business Law Attorney: A business law attorney can assist in various legal matters related to starting, operating, and managing a business in South Dakota. They can provide guidance on corporate formation, regulatory compliance, contract negotiation, intellectual property, employment law, and more. 2. Real Estate Attorney: Real estate attorneys specialize in legal issues concerning property transactions, such as buying or selling real estate, lease agreements, property disputes, zoning and land use, and title examinations. 3. Family Law Attorney: Family law attorneys handle legal matters related to family and domestic relationships, including divorce, child custody, prenuptial agreements, adoption, spousal support, and child support. They can provide legal representation and advice during emotionally challenging situations. 4. Personal Injury Attorney: Personal injury attorneys assist individuals who have been injured due to someone else's negligence or wrongdoing. They can handle cases involving car accidents, medical malpractice, product liability, premises liability, and wrongful death, seeking compensation for the victims. 5. Criminal Defense Attorney: Criminal defense attorneys represent individuals accused of committing a crime in South Dakota. They ensure their clients' rights are protected, gather evidence, negotiate plea bargains, challenge the prosecution's case, and present a strong defense in court. 6. Employment Law Attorney: Employment law attorneys specialize in matters related to workplace issues, including wrongful termination, discrimination, harassment, wage disputes, employee contracts, and labor law compliance. They can assist both employers and employees in navigating South Dakota's employment laws.
